CYCOLOY™ CY6310 resin

About
CYCOLOY™   CY6310 resin Flame retardant PC/ABS blend using non-brominated and non-chlorinated flame retardant systems, offering hydrolytic stability and excellent flow / impact balance for a wide variety of thin wall or large size applications including business equipment, enclosures, among others.&&

Process Conditions
injectionNominal valueUnitTest method
Drying temperature90 to 100°C
Drying time2.0 to 4.0hr
Recommended maximum moisture content0.020%
Hopper temperature60 to 80°C
Barrel rear temperature210 to 240°C
Barrel middle temperature230 to 270°C
Barrel front temperature240 to 280°C
Nozzle temperature230 to 270°C
Processing (melt) temperature250 to 280°C
Mold temperature60 to 90°C
